Oracle误删除数据:事例与补救措施
在Oracle数据库中,误删除数据是一种常见的错误。以下是具体的一个事例以及可能的补救措施。
事例:
假设您是数据库管理员,正在管理一个包含用户信息的表。在一次操作中,由于误解或者疏忽,您误删了一条记录,包括该用户的ID和详细信息。
补救措施:
立即停止操作:一旦发现误删除,应立刻停止所有相关的SQL语句,防止进一步的数据丢失。
查看事务日志:Oracle数据库在事务执行过程中会生成详细的事务日志。你可以在日志中定位到误删除记录的查询时间。
使用
RETRIEVE
或RESTORE
命令恢复数据:如果能找回事务日志,可以使用RETRIEVE
命令从日志中恢复被删除的数据。然而,这个过程可能会因为日志损坏或者日志文件未正确保存而失败。
总之,误删除数据在Oracle数据库管理中常见,需要采取紧急措施以最大程度减少损失。
还没有评论,来说两句吧...